DGTP model
A bit is ascribed to each output:

The bit at 1 is interpreted as active output, while the bit at 0 as disabled output.
If, for example, one wants to enable simultaneously the OUT6, OUT4 and OUT2 outputs, the binary combination will
be

Which, in hexadecimals, corresponds to the number 002A; therefore the command will be OUTP0002A + CR + LF.
NOTES:
- The set point enabling command does not work neither in the set-up environment nor in the weighing phase; if the
setpoint mode has been selected and the output function is different than "nonE". (rif. output step, FunC parameter).
- No output is ascribed to the bits from 6 to 15 and are fixed at zero.
